Unlocking the Secrets of Revival: A Deep Dive into the Mechanics of 4 Simple Steps To Revive Your Favourite Sleeping Bag
So, what exactly involves in reviving a sleeping bag, and why is it becoming increasingly popular? At its core, the process can be broken down into four simple yet essential steps:
- Step 1: Cleaning and Inspection – A thorough examination of the sleeping bag's fabric, zippers, and other components to identify areas of wear and tear.
- Step 2: Repair and Maintenance – Addressing issues such as torn seams, broken zippers, and worn-out insulation to ensure the bag remains functional and cozy.
- Step 3: Restoration and Upcycling – Transforming the sleeping bag into a unique, one-of-a-kind item, often incorporating repurposed materials and creative embellishments.
- Step 4: Protection and Preservation – Applying specialized treatments and coatings to extend the bag's lifespan, safeguard against the elements, and maintain its water-repellent properties.
By breaking down the revival process into tangible, manageable steps, individuals can regain a sense of control over their belongings, reduce waste, and cultivate a deeper connection with their gear.
